Élisabeth Louise Vigée Le Brun’s Self-Portrait is a powerful representation of her talent and individuality. Vigée Le Brun was a prominent French portrait artist in the late 18th and early 19th centuries, widely known for her work as the court painter to Marie Antoinette. Her self-portrait reflects her independence as a female artist and offers insight into the social position of women at the time.
In this work, Vigée Le Brun portrays herself confidently, with an elegant posture and a self-assured expression. Holding a paintbrush, she depicts herself actively engaged in her craft, imbuing the portrait with a sense of pride in her profession. The soft tones in the background and the richness of her attire highlight both her grace and the challenges faced by women artists of her era.
